• ベストアンサー

連立微分方程式の問題で、大学の先生の説明と、定理を使った場合との答えの比較

連立線形微分方程式の問題です。 大学で火曜日に試験があって、勉強はしているのですが、 講義がすごく分かりにくく、教科書もこの講義をしている教授が 執筆している、わかりにくいものですので、 わからないところが多々あり、困っています。 その中でも、どうしても気がかりなところがありますので、 長文になりますが、ご指導お願いいたします。 d/dx・x(t)=A・x(t) ただしA=(9  13)      (-5 -7) (↑x(t)は太字です。またAの行列が見にくくてすみません。) の一般解を求めようと思うのですが、 講義での方法では以下のような答えとなります。 ***講義での答え*** 固有値が1±iとなるので、固有ベクトルu1が( 8+i )                     ( -5 ) これを(8)+i(1)=a+ibとし、(a,bは太字表記です。)    (5) (0)  最終的に与式の一般解は、 x(t)=c1・e^t・(costa-sintb)+c2・e^t(costb+sinta)(教科書) x(t)=e^t(c1・cost+c2・sint)a+e^t(-c1・sint+c2・cost)b(板書) ***ここまで*** とてつもなく長いので、計算過程は省かせていただいたのですが、 本当に見づらくて申し訳ありません。 講義の方法だと、いくら考えても解き方が分かりませんので、 ネットで調べて、下記ページを見つけました。 http://next1.cc.it-hiroshima.ac.jp/MULTIMEDIA/diffpub/node33.html 講義の方法を一旦諦め、このページの中の、定理3.1を用いて出した答えが以下のようになります。 ***定理3.1を用いた解き方*** 固有値が1±iとなるので、1+iに対する固有ベクトルu1が( 8+i )                           ( -5 ) ここまでは講義と同じですが、定理を用いるので、a,bなどに分けません。 固有値1-iに対する固有ベクトルu2は( 8-i )                  ( -5 )となります。                    定理より、 x(t)=c1・(8+i)・e^((1+i)t)+c2・(8-i)・e^((1-i)t)      (5 )          (5 ) としました。 ***ここまで*** 試験でまったく手がつけられないよりは、すこしでも埋めたいと思っているので、 この定理を用いようかと思うのですが、 回答の形が、教科書、板書ともに異なっているのが、すごく気になります。 オイラーの公式などを用いて、変形できるか確かめてみたのですが、 (変形できれば、もし×をつけられたときでも、後から抗議できますので。) 私の数学の力では、定理と教科書(あるいは板書)、相互での変形が うまくいきません。 そこで、ご指導いただきたいのですが、 1.定理を用いて出した回答は、数学的に正しいのでしょうか? 2.定理を使って出した回答を教科書の式、あるいは板書の式に変形する方法をご教授いただけませんでしょうか? 見づらい上、長文を書いてしまい、申し訳ありません。 本当に困っていますので、ご指導いただけますとうれしいです。 お手数ですが、よろしくお願いいたします。

  • exboy
  • お礼率65% (25/38)

質問者が選んだベストアンサー

  • ベストアンサー
  • ojisan7
  • ベストアンサー率47% (489/1029)
回答No.3

こんにちは。 No2です。適当な教え方をしてごめんなさい。 No2の「一般解でe^(it)をcos(t)に、e^(-it)をsin(t)に書き換えるだけでよい。」は撤回します。ともかく、言いたいことは、一般解は虚数単位の含まれない形に表すことが大切だということです。 お詫びの意味で、「講義と、サイトの定理との関連性」の部分について補足します。 x(t)=c1(a+ib)e^[(1+i)t]+c2(a-bi)e^[(1-i)t] の右辺を実数部分と虚数部分にまとめます。すると、 x(t)=(c1+c2)e^t(acost-bsint)+i(c1-c2)e^t(asint+bcost) となりますが、右辺の(c1+c2)を改めてC1に、i(c1-c2)をC2に変換すれば良いです。こうすれば、板書と一致します。 講義で教えてくれている先生は、良い先生だと思いますよ。やはり、講義をしっかり聴くことが大切です。頑張って下さいね。 それでは。

exboy
質問者

お礼

ご丁寧にご指導いただきましてありがとうございました。 今日試験だったのですが、この考え方を使う問題は出ませんでした(笑 しかし考え方をご指導いただき、これを元に、なんとか自分なりに 答えを出せるところまでは行けたので、本当に助かりました。 ご指導いただき、ありがとうございました。

その他の回答 (3)

  • reiman
  • ベストアンサー率62% (102/163)
回答No.4

w^*をwの複素共役とする。 x'(t)=Ax(t)の解はx(t)=exp(At)x(0) A=PΛP^-1とすると x(t)=Pexp(Λt)P^-1x(0)...(1) ただし Λ= [λ 0] [0 λ^*] λ:Aの固有値 P=[p p^*] p:Aの固有値λに対応する固有2次元列ベクトル (1)より x(t)=(cp)exp(λt)+(cp)^*exp(λ^*t)...(2) ただしcはP^-1x(0)の第1成分 (2)より x(t)=2exp(αt)(ucos(βt)-vsin(βt)) ただし uはcpの実部列ベクトル、vはcpの虚部列ベクトル

exboy
質問者

お礼

ご指導いただきまして、ありがとうございました。 参考にさせていただき、今日の試験に臨むことが出来ました。 ありがとうございました。

  • ojisan7
  • ベストアンサー率47% (489/1029)
回答No.2

こんばんは。 最終的に示された与式の一般解は、教科書と板書でちょっと違うようですが、よく見ると同じですね。 感想ですが、a、bというベクトルを導入する講義の方法は非常にうまいやり方をしています。見習うべきだと思います。教授の教科書で充分のような気がします。 >1.定理を用いて出した回答は、数学的に正しいのでしょうか? 間違いではないですが、それではまだ不十分です。最終的に教科書や板書のように三角関数を使って虚数単位の含まれない形にする必要があります。 >2.定理を使って出した回答を教科書の式、あるいは板書の式に変形する方法をご教授いただけませんでしょうか? 結論を言えば、一般解でe^(it)をcos(t)に、e^(-it)をsin(t)に書き換えるだけでよい。(この理由はご自分で考えてください。) 尚、講義と、サイトの定理との関連性は、 x(t)=c1(a+ib)e^[(1+i)t]+c2(a-bi)e^[(1-i)t] です。この式をsin,cosに書き換えれば、板書と一致するはずです。

  • Tacosan
  • ベストアンサー率23% (3656/15482)
回答No.1

2 だけ. といっても, オイラーの公式などで地道にバラすだけですが.

関連するQ&A

  • 連立微分方程式の解き方について

    次の問題の解き方を教えて下さい。 できれば途中の過程も教えて頂ければありがたいです。 問、一般解を求めよ。 1.dx/dt = -7x + y dy/dx = -2x - 5y 2.dx/dt = 4x + y +2e^(3t) dy/dt = -2x + y -3e^(3t) 3. dx/dt = x - y + t^2 dy/dt = 2x - y + t^2 - t 答え1.x = e^(-6t) (C1 cost + C2 sint) y = e^(-6t) ((C1+C2)cos t + (C2-C1) sin t) 2.x = C1 e^(2t) + C2 e^(3t) + t e^(3t) y = -2C1 e^(2t) - (1 + C2)e^(3t) - te^(3t) 3.x = 3t + C1 cos t + C2 sin t y = t^2 + 3t - 3 + (C1 - C2) cos t + (C1 + C2) sin t 個人的にわからないところは何度計算しても(C2-C1)のような式が 全く出てこないので困っています。3についてはx=3t + (1/2)C1 cos t + (1/2)C2 sin tの ようになってしまいました。

  • 連立微分方程式に関して

    dx/dt=-x+z dy/dt=-2x+y+z dz/dt=x-y+2z という問題で A-sI=-1-s 0 1 -2 1-s 1 1 -1 2-s |A-sI|=-(1-s*2)(2-s)で固有値が1 -1 2 なのはわかったのですが、その後の固有ベクトルを求める際につまりました s=1の時    -2 0 1 u 0   -2u+w=0 -2 0 1 ・ v = 0 → u-v+w=0 1 -1 1 w 0 となり3変数だけども2式しかなく求めれません。どうすればいいんでしょうか。

  • 微分方程式の問題です

    x(t)''+2ax(t)'+(1+a^2)x=sintを考える。 (1)同次方程式x(t)''+2ax(t)'+(1+a^2)x=0の一般解を求めよ。 (2)同次方程式x(t)''+2ax(t)'+(1+a^2)x=0に対して、初期条件x(0)=0,x(0)'=1を与えた時の特解を求めよ。 (3)a=0の時、非同次方程式x(t)''+2ax(t)'+(1+a^2)x=sin(t)の特解を求めよ。 以上です。 自分で解いたのですが、合っていますでしょうか?また、はずれていれば解説付きで解き方お願いいたします。ただし、(3)については解けませんでした。 (1) x(t)=C1exp{(-a+i)t}+C2exp{-(a+i)t} (2) x(t)=(-i/2)exp{(-a+i)t}+(i/2)exp{-(a+i)t} (3) a=0なので、x(t)''+x=sin(x)となって、未定係数法を使って解いた方がよろしいのでしょうか? その場合、x(t)=x(sin(x)+cox(x))とおいて、微分方程式に代入して解くのですか?

  • 微分方程式の問題お願いします

    微分方程式の問題お願いします インダクタンスL、容量C、抵抗Rと電源を直列に接続する この電気回路を流れる電流I(t)は次の2階微分方程式を満たすとき以下の問いに答えよ L*d^2I/dt^2+R*dI/dt+I/C=dV/dt・・・(1) (1)V(t)=Eのとき(1)の一般解を求めよ (2)V(t)=sint、 L=R=C=1とする (1)の特解を,I(t)=acost+bsintとしたとき、aとbを求めよ この微分方程式を解け (3)dy/dx=-(x^3+4x^3y^3)/(y^2+3x^4y^2) (3)しかできなくて x^4/4+x^4y^3+y^3/3=Cとなりました 残りの問題お願いします

  • 連立微分方程式 行列

    この問題がどうしても分からないので数学のできる方お願いします。 Q.次の連立微分方程式を解け   x'(t)= x(t) -y(t)+4z(t)   y'(t)=3x(t)+2y(t) -z(t)   z'(t)=2x(t) +y(t) -(t) この問題の前の問題で A=(1 -1 4) (3 2 -1) (2 1 -1)←行列 の固有値、固有ベクトル、Aの対角化、自然数nに対するA^n を求めたのですがここで使用するのでしょうか?

  • 非斉次の微分方程式の問題で答えが合いませんでした

    非斉次の微分方程式の問題で答えが合いませんでした y'-2y=5sint y(0)=0 これを解いていくと 斉次方程式 y'-2y=0 これをといて y=Ae^(2t) 係数 A を A(t) と見なして y'=A'e^(2t)+2Ae^(2t) 元の非政治方程式にい代入して A'e^(2t)=5sint A=5∫sin(t)e^(-2t)dt =5{-cos(t)e^(-2t)-1/2sin(t)e^(-2t)-1/4∫sin(t)e^(-2t)dt} =5{-cos(t)e^(-2t)-1/2sin(t)e^(-2t)-(1/4)(A/5)+C} (5/4)A=-5cos(t)e^(-2t)-(5/2)sin(t)e^(-2t)+C A=-4cos(t)e^(-2t)-2sin(t)e^(-2t)+C y=-4cos(t)-2sin(t)+Ce^(2t) y(0)=-1+C C=1 y=-4cos(t)-2sin(t)+e^(2t) になりましたが、答えは y=e^(2t)-cos(t)-2sin(t) となっていて計算が合いません どこが間違っているのか教えてください

  • グリーン関数(連立常微分方程式)について

    お世話になっております。 グリーン関数を連立常微分方程式を解くような解法でやっていたら、参考書の解答と一か所異なる場所が出たのですが、よくわからなかったので質問させていただきます。 問題: uはxのみの関数であり -u'' +a^2 u = f(x) B.C. u(0) =α u(L)=β のとき、u(x)を求めよ。 解答: 連立常微分方程式として変形すると U=[u u']T (ただしTは転置のT) M=[-a 0] [0 a] (ただしM=2*2の行列 P=[1 1] [-a a] (ただしP=2*2の行列 V=[v1 v2]T U=PV とすると 与式は V'= MV + P-1[0 -f(x)]T = MV + f(x)/2a [1 -1]T すなわち v1' = -av1 + f(x)/2a v2' = av2 - f(x)/2a となります。 ここまでは僕の解答と参考書のそれは一致してます。 以降簡単のためv1のみ議論の対象とさせていただきます。 【参考書では】 v1= C1e^-ax + e^-ax∫(e^ay/2a)f(y)dy 積分区間0 to x となっております。 もちろんこのあとVからUに変換して、B.C.考えてu(x)を求めますが、これ以降は大丈夫そうなので割愛させていただきます。 【僕がやった解答は】 http://markun.cs.shinshu-u.ac.jp/learn/biseki/no_10/liner.html を用いたのですが、つまり v1' = -av1 の同次形の答えをz1(=C1e^-ax)としますと v1=w(x) z1と仮定して v1' = -av1 + f(x)/2aに代入すると w'= f(x)/(2az1) が出るので w=∫f(x)/(2az1) dx + C2 (不定積分) ゆえに v1 = wz1 = C3e^-ax + e^-ax∫(e^ax/2a)f(x)dx (不定積分) となり、参考書のものと異なってしまいます。 積分の文字事態は別にどうでもいいということは理解してますが ∫(e^ay/2a)f(y)dy 積分区間0 to x ∫(e^ax/2a)f(x)dx とは全く別物ですよね? どなたか、どこが間違っているのかご指摘して願えませんか? どうかよろしくお願いいたします。

  • 連立微分方程式の解き方について

    Aの連立微分方程式 {y'₁(x)=4y₁(x)+2y₂(x) {y'₂(x)=2y₁(x)+3y₂(x) 初期条件 y₁(0) = 2, y₂(0) = 1 ↑ Aの連立微分方程式からまず行列を書くので |4 2| |2 3| ↑ と書きます。しかしここから固有値を求め、さらに固有値に対する固有ベクトル計算するとどうしても計算できなく、計算サイト(WolframAlpha)を使っても√を含む値が出てしまい、計算できなくなってしまいます。 問題を記載するにあたってタイピングミス等はありません。 誰か、わかる人教えてもらえないでしょうか? マジで解けなくてほんとに困っています。

  • 連立微分方程式

    dx/dt = 2x dy/dt = cos(t)*x+y の一般解について,僕が出した答えは以下のようなのですが,正解なのかがわかりません。 x = C1e^(2t) y = e^t{C1*e^(t)/2(sin(t)+cos(t))+C2} C1,C2は任意定数。

  • 二階線形常微分方程式の問題について教えてください。

    二階線形常微分方程式の問題について教えてください。 y"+2y'+2y=0,y(0)=1,y'(0)=1 の解き方ですが、 λ1=-1+i,λ2=-1-i より a=-1,b=1 となりました。 一般解が y(t)=e^(at)(C1cos(bt)+C2sin(bt)) なので y(0)=C1=1 y'(t)=ae^(at)(-C1bsin(bt)+C2bcos(bt)) y'(0)=-C2=1 C2=-1 よって y(t)=e^(-t)(cost-sint) と解きましたが答えは y(t)=e^(-t)(cost+2sint) となっています。 どこが間違っているのか教えてください。